Your story advancement is divided among NM, TVHM, and UVHM (excluding OP tiers). You can't redo Normal mode, but side missions or DLCs not finished in Normal can be completed separately in TVHM and UVHM without affecting the others. tl;dr: Yes, you're free to switch back anytime.
